How it works
Develop wrestling-specific conditioning and effort by combining live scrambling with structured conditioning demands.
What you need
- wrestling mat
Your focus
Wrestling conditioning must mirror the effort bursts and recovery patterns of actual matches, not just general fitness. This drill creates authentic match-intensity effort while building the specific metabolic fitness that wrestling requires. Wrestlers who are conditioned through wrestling-specific drills maintain effort levels in late-match situations.
Live scramble for 30 seconds, maximum effort, both wrestlers attacking.
Immediately: both wrestlers do 10 sprawls without stopping.
Return to live scramble for 30 more seconds.
Repeat for five total scramble-sprawl cycles; no recovery between cycles.
Goal
Success is your last scramble being just as sharp as your first, conditioning effort shouldn't slow down your technical effort.
